Analysis

Comoros recorded 4.0% for share of population not using improved drinking water sources in 2024. That is the lowest value across all 25 years on record.

The figure is down 5.2% on the previous year and down 34.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, share of population not using improved drinking water sources in Comoros peaked at 8.8% in 2000 and was at its lowest, 4.0%, in 2024.

Comoros ranks 70th of 231 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 25 years of available data.

Proportion of people not using improved drinking water sources. These people might use surface water sources or unprotected springs or wells, as no safe and reliable improved drinking water source is available to them.
